Analysis
Costa Rica recorded 0.9119 for imports exports plastic income group in 2023.
Compared with earlier readings it is up 17.5% on the previous year and down 37.5% over ten years.
Over the whole period, imports exports plastic income group in Costa Rica peaked at 1.99 in 2016 and was at its lowest, 0.5717, in 2020.
Costa Rica ranks 34th of 172 countries on this measure, in the top quarter.
The long-run direction has been consistently falling across the 15 years of available data.
